Royal Bank of Canada

FINANCIAL SERVICES · BANKS - DIVERSIFIED · USA

Royal Bank of Canada is a globally diversified financial services company. The company is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.

WesBanco Inc

FINANCIAL SERVICES · BANKS - REGIONAL · USA

WesBanco, Inc. is the banking holding company for WesBanco Bank, Inc. offering retail banking, corporate banking, personal and corporate trust, brokerage, mortgage banking, and insurance services. The company is headquartered in Wheeling, West Virginia.
